MLC 2026 Schedule Announced, Super Kings To Play Tournament Opener



MLC 2026 schedule revealed [Source: @MLCricket/x]MLC 2026 schedule revealed [Source: @MLCricket/x]

The schedule of the upcoming fourth edition of the Major League Cricket (MLC) has been finally unveiled. The official social media pages of MLC dropped the entire itinerary on Friday, March 20, i.e., roughly a couple of months prior to the launch of the season.

As per the entire MLC 2026 schedule, the Texas Super Kings and Seattle Orcas will be crossing paths in the opening match of the tournament on June 18. Defending champions MI New York, on the other hand, will play their first match on the third day of the competition at the Grand Prairie Cricket Stadium in Texas.

MLC 2026 schedule out, new season to be played in 3 venues

The entire schedule of the upcoming MLC 2026 season has been finally unveiled by the tournament officials. All six competing franchises, namely Los Angeles Knight Riders, San Francisco Unicorns, Seattle Orcas, Texas Super Kings, Washington Freedom and defending champions MI New York will be making their return to the league’s roaster.

Much like the 2025 edition of the tournament last year, the MLC 2026 season will once again feature 34 matches, including 30 league fixtures and four knockout games. The entire season will be hosted by three USA venues, namely the Grand Prairie Cricket Stadium in Grand Prairie, the Oakland Coliseum in Oakland and the Knight Riders Cricket Field in Fairplex Pomona.

MLC 2026 season format

The MLC 2026 season will follow the familiar double round-robin format. All six teams will be facing each other twice as per the standard ‘home and away’ formatting schedule. The top four teams at the end of the 30-match opening round will qualify for the playoffs.

The teams securing a top-two finish in the league stage will face each other in the qualifier, with the winner advancing directly to the final, while the loser will get another chance to qualify by playing in the second qualifier against the winner of the eliminator.

What happened in last year’s MLC?

The third edition of the MLC, also known as MLC 2025, was played between June 12 and July 13 last year across three different venues.

Despite finishing fourth on the league stage, the MI New York franchise won the MLC 2025 title by defeating table-toppers and tournament favorites Washington Freedom on the day of the final in Grand Prairie. Fast bowler Rushil Ugarkar bagged the ‘Player of the Match’ award for picking up the important wickets of Rachin Ravindra and Glenn Maxwell.

Texas Super Kings and San Francisco Unicorns also made it to the playoffs by finishing second and third respectively on the six-team standings. However, both Super Kings and Unicorns lost to MI New York in the Challenger and the Eliminator respectively to get knocked out of the competition.

Teams like the Seattle Orcas and the Los Angeles Knight Riders failed to make it to the top four.
